2026-07-072026-07-07http://salesiana.dossiersoluciones.com/handle/123456789/57404In this paper, we compute the next-nearest-neighboring site percolation (Connections exist not only between nearest-neighboring sites, but also between next-nearest-neighboring sites.) probabilities Pc on the two-dimensional Sierpinski carpets, using the translational-dilation method and Monte Carlo technique. We obtain a relation among Pc, fractal dimensionality D and connectivity Q.
